SAA 15 337. Fragment Referring to Mares (ABL 1270)

~715 BCE·Neo-Assyrian·P334824

(Beginning destroyed) (r 2) the troops [...] (r 3) [be i]t mare[s ...] (r 4) or depor[tees ...] (r 5) with the rest [...] (r 6) in the service of the ch[ief ...] (r 7) let me appoint [...] (r 8) as far as Pa[...] (r 9) they say [...] (Rest destroyed)

Royal correspondence from Babylonia and the eastern provinces under Sargon II, edited by Andreas Fuchs & Simo Parpola (SAA 15, 2001). ORACC text P334824.
